Fundamentals of Artificial Intelligence and Big Data Technology
(6 class hours in total)



Introduction to Artificial Intelligence and Application Scenarios(40 minutes)



  • Understand the basic concepts and development of AI, and introduce the typical applications of AI in the financial field.
  • Illustrate cases of machine learning and robo - advisory.


Introduction to Python Programming and Financial Data Processing (60 minutes)



  • Programming basics and environment setup. Master methods of financial data cleaning and analysis.


Explanation of Basic Machine Learning Algorithms (80 minutes)



  • Common algorithms for supervised/unsupervised learning, with a focus on analyzing classification, clustering, and regression.


Introduction to Big Data Platforms and the Process of Financial Data Analysis (50 minutes)



  • The basic architectures of Hadoop/Spark, and the setup of big data environment. A panoramic introduction to the pipeline of financial data analysis.


Hands - on Practice of AI Models - Demonstration of Portfolio Optimization (70 minutes)



  • Project hands - on practice, from data acquisition to model building. Implement a simple intelligent investment portfolio based on Python.


Case Analysis and Summary (40 minutes)



  • Analyze practical cases, answer questions, and summarize the core knowledge of this module.
